Which function is a horizontal compression of its parent function f(x)=x^7 by a factor of 4

Answer:

r(x)=(4x)^7


Step-by-step explanation:

  • For a horizontal compression, we multiply whole numbers greater than 1 in front of x of the given function.
  • For horizontal expansion, we multiply by the reciprocal of the number for horizontal compression, in front of x of the function.

For example,

If we wanted to <u>horizontally compress</u> y=x^2, we would multiply by 4 to get y=(4x)^2, and

if we wante to <u>horizontally expand</u> y=x^2, we would multiply by \frac{1}{4} to get y=(\frac{1}{4}x)^2


Since this question asks for horizontal compression, we multiply the x of the function by 4. So the function we need is f(x)=(4x)^7. The second choice is correct.

What is the square root of 50x^4
love history [14]

Answer:

5x²√2

Step-by-step explanation:

√50x^{4}

The <em>square root of x^4 is x²</em>.

The <em>square root of 50 is 5√2</em>.

Multiplying those two gives us 5x²√2
